About Gusto
Gusto is a modern, online people platform that helps small businesses take care of their teams. It offers full-service payroll, health insurance, 401(k)s, expert HR, and team management tools. Gusto's offices are in Denver, San Francisco, and New York, serving over 400,000 businesses nationwide.

About The Role
As a staff product designer, you will help mature our contractor products, driving foundational shifts in our platform and customer experiences. You will influence major experience changes in critical workflows, from setting long-term visions to launching and iterating features.
About The Team
Contractors are vital to the economy, offering flexibility and independence. Our Contractors team supports SMBs in hiring, managing, and paying contractors, both domestic and international, and helps contractors manage client engagements and grow their businesses.
